Linux `touch` 命令深度解析与高阶应用指南

[复制链接]
发表于 2025-5-19 12:40:46 | 显示全部楼层 |阅读模式

<hr>
  
<hr> 一、核心功能解析

1. 基本作用



  • 创建空文件(文件不存在时主动新建)
  • 修改时间戳(访问时间/修改时间)
  • 兼容性处置惩罚(支持特殊文件名)
  • 批量操作(支持多个文件参数)
2. 与雷同操作对比

    操作   核心差异点   典型应用场景         touch   精确控制时间戳   文件标志/空文件创建       > 重定向   覆盖文件内容   快速清空文件       echo > file   写入内容并修改时间   初始化配置文件       stat   仅查看时间戳   文件状态查抄   <hr> 二、选项系统详解

1. 基础选项阐明

    选项   功能阐明   示例         -a   仅修改访问时间   touch -a file       -m   仅修改修改时间   touch -m file       -c   不创建新文件   touch -c not_exist       -r   参考其他文件的时间   touch -r ref.txt target.txt       -t   指定时间戳(格式:[[CC]YY]MMDDhhmm[.ss])   touch -t 202405201530.30 file   2. 时间格式阐明

  1. 时间格式示例
  2. 202405201530.30 → 2024年5月20日15:30:30
  3. 9805201530      → 1998</
复制代码
免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
回复

使用道具 举报

登录后关闭弹窗

登录参与点评抽奖  加入IT实名职场社区
去登录
快速回复 返回顶部 返回列表